General information Xeon E5-1620 v2 Xeon E3-1290 V2
Launched Q3 2013 Q2 2012
Used in Server Server
Factory Intel Intel
Socket FCLGA2011 LGA1155
Clock 3.7 GHz 0 % 3.7 GHz 0 %
Turbo Clock 3.9 GHz 4.9 % 4.1 GHz 0 %
Cores 4 0 % 4 0 %
Threads 8 0 % 8 0 %
Thermal Design Power (TDP) 130 W 0 % 87 W 33.1 %
